Official title: An Open-label, Randomized, Single Dose, Two-Period Crossover study to Determine the Bioavailability of a Fixed Dose Combination Capsule Formulation of Dutasteride and Tamsulosin Hydrochloride (0.5mg/0.2mg) Relative to Co-administration of Dutasteride 0.5mg capsules and Tamsulosin Hydrochloride 0.2mg
Trial description: This study will be an open-label, randomized, single dose, two-period crossover study to determine the bioavailability of a fixed dose combination capsule formulation of dutasteride and tamsulosin hydrochloride (0.5mg/0.2mg) relative to co-administration of dutasteride 0.5mg capsules and tamsulosin hydrochloride 0.2mg tablets in healthy male subjects of North East Asian and non-Asian ancestry. Subjects will receive single oral doses of a combination capsule formulation of dutasteride 0.5 mg/ tamsulosin 0.2 mg in a fed or fasted state or concomitant dosing of dutasteride 0.5 mg and the Japan-sourced Harnal-D 0.2 mg in a fed or fasted state. Each dose of study medication will be separated by a 28-day washout period. Blood samples for pharmacokinetic analysis will be taken at regular intervals after dosing. Safety will be assessed by measurement of blood pressure, heart rate, safety laboratory data, and review of adverse events. The study will enrol 88 healthy male subjects to ensure that 80 complete the study. At least twenty percent of the study population will be of Japanese ancestry, approximately 20% will be of Chinese ancestry and approximately 20% of Korean ancestry while the remainder of the population will be of non-Asian ancestry.

Primary outcomes:

1. To investigate the bioavailability of a combination capsule formulation of dutasteride 0.5 mg/ tamsulosin HCl 0.2 mg relative to concomitant dosing of dutasteride 0.5 mg capsules and tamsulosin 0.2 mg tablets in the fed and fasted states.

Timeframe: PK at pre-dose, at 15,30 and 45 min; 1, 2,3,4,6,8,10,12,16,24,48,and 72 hours.

Secondary outcomes:

1. To investigate the effect of food on the bioavailability of a combination capsule formulation of dutasteride 0.5 mg/ tamsulosin HCl 0.2 mg relative to concomitant dosing of dutasteride 0.5 mg capsules and tamsulosin 0.2 mg tablets.

Timeframe: PK at pre-dose, 15, 30,and 45 mins; 1,2,3,4,6,8,10,12,16,24,48,and 72 hrs.

    • Healthy as determined by a responsible and experienced physician, based on a medical evaluation including medical history, physical examination, laboratory tests and cardiac monitoring. A subject with a clinical abnormality or laboratory parameters outside the reference range for the population being studied may be included only if the Investigator and the GSK Medical Monitor agree that the finding is unlikely to introduce additional risk factors and will not interfere with the study procedures.
    • Males between 20 and 45 years of age inclusive, at the time of signing the informed consent form.
    • Medical Conditions Exclusions:
    • Poor metabolizer for CYP2D6 substrates as determined by genotyping of selected CYP2D6 variants at screening.
